The truth is the fog is there to prevent you from seeing how empty the inaccessible areas are. Tranzit is a massive map and they couldn't overload it with "surrounding decoretion" so they just masked it with the fog. Removing it would definitely help fps. but 9 years later it would barely make any difference with today's hardware. that's why people want tranzit to be remade even though it is regarded as one of the worst maps. because it has potential.

yeah, I believe the original reason for the existence of fog and denizens was deterring players from going outside of main areas (except passing through with bus). from what I've read on internet, previous generation consoles (PS3 & X360) weren't powerful enough to provide acceptable performance for tranzit, if devs had put some high-quality work for all those big environments. they could have done it for PCs where hardware limitation is less of an issue, but treyarch possibly didn't want to get backlash by console users (and even Sony/Microsoft), or the system requirements would be slightly higher on PC, leading to less sale numbers for activision.
